Comprehending Ballistic Protection Levels

Wiki Article

Ballistic protection levels indicate the capability of a material to mitigate objects. These levels are frequently determined using standardized protocols, which involve firing projectiles at the protective material from numerous distances and speeds.

Derived from these tests, ballistic protection levels are assigned using a numerical scale. This classification helps consumers evaluate the level of defense offered by different materials and select the appropriate protection for their needs.

It's important to note that ballistic protection levels are not a assurance against all threats. Other factors, such as the angle of the projectile, the composition of the material, and the design of the protective gear, can also influence its effectiveness.

The Science Behind Ballistic Protection

Ballistic protection relies on a complex interplay of material science and engineering principles. When a projectile impacts a ballistic barrier, it experiences a deceleration force brought about by the rigid construction and dense materials employed. This abrupt change in momentum results in a transfer of energy, some of which is dissipated as heat and sound, while the remaining energy may cause deformation or fragmentation within the projectile itself.

The effectiveness of ballistic protection largely depends on the chosen materials, their density, thickness, and arrangement. Commonly used materials include steel, ceramic composites, and advanced polymers, each with unique properties that contribute to the overall performance of the barrier.
